    摘要:

    目的 分析线粒体转录因子B1(transcription factor B1,mitochondrial,TFB1M)在肝癌细胞中的生物学作用,初步探讨其调控HCC恶性转移的分子机制。方法 基于TCGA-LIHC(Liver Hepatocellular Carcinoma)和GEO肝癌相关数据库分析TFB1M在肝癌中的表达水平及其与肝癌患者临床特征的关系;基于TFB1M表达水平中位值,将TCGA-LIHC样本分为TFB1M低表达组(n=170)和TFB1M高表达组(n=170),以高表达组为对照组,利用GSEA进行基因集富集分析;构建过表达TFB1M质粒,转染肝癌HepG2和Huh7细胞。采用CCK-8、流式细胞术、划痕愈合、Transwell小室等检测过表达TFB1M对肝癌细胞生长、细胞周期分布、迁移和侵袭的影响。结果 与正常肝组织相比,TFB1M在肝癌组织中表达水平明显降低(P<0.05);且TFB1M表达水平与肝癌患者性别有关(P<0.05)。GSEA富集分析结果显示,TFB1M低表达组主要与肝癌增殖增强基因集、肝细胞癌干性增强基因集、和细胞外基质组装基因集有关。细胞生物学实验结果显示,与空载组相比,过表达TFB1M后,肝癌细胞迁移和侵袭能力均下降(均P<0.05),而细胞生长和细胞周期分布无显著改变(均P>0.05)。结论 TFB1M在肝细胞癌中呈显著低表达,过表达TFB1M能够显著抑制肝癌细胞迁移和侵袭。

    Abstract:

    Objective To explore the effect of transcription factor B1,mitochondrial,(TFB1M) on cell survival and migration of hepatocellular carcinoma cells and related molecular mechanisms. Methods TFB1M gene was overexpressed by transfection of eukaryotic recombinant plasmid. Cell survival and cell cycle distribution were detected by CCK-8 and flow cytometry. Cell migration and invasion were assessed by scratch healing and transwell chamber assays. Results The expression of TFB1M was significantly decreased in HCC, and the expression of TFB1M was more lower in female HCC patients than that tin male HCC patients. The mRNA expression of TFB1M was significantly increased after transfection of recombinant plasmid. Moreover, our results showed that overexpression of TFB1M had no effect on the growth and cell cycle distribution of HepG2 and Huh7 cells. However, overexpession of TFB1M remarkably attenuated the migration and invasion activity of HCC cells(all P<0.05). The results from the bioinformatics presented that the low expression of TFB1M might be related to the extracellular matrix assembly gene set in HCC. Conclusions TFB1M regulates the cell metastasis and invasion through influencing extracellular matrix assembly in HCC.
